It all began with a cat named Ace — a gentle soul whose calm, golden presence could soften even the hardest day. To those who knew him, Ace wasn’t just a pet; he was a symbol of resilience and love. But his path to peace hadn’t been easy.


A Difficult Start

Ace’s life began in hardship. Found as a frail stray kitten, weak and trembling on the streets, he had already seen more struggle in his first few weeks than most animals do in a lifetime. A severe infection took one of his eyes — leaving behind a small scar that told the story of survival.

But where others saw loss, Ace carried quiet strength. His missing eye never slowed him down. He grew up playful and curious, learning to chase beams of sunlight across the floor and nap in the warm glow of afternoon light.

To him, life was still beautiful.
To the world, however, he looked “different.”

“People don’t always know how to react when they see him,” said his owner, Norma Maikovich. “Especially kids — they’re not sure what to think.”

Yet Ace’s spirit never dimmed. His heart remained full of love, his purrs deep and comforting. He greeted every visitor with a hopeful nudge, as if to say, See me. I’m still here.


The Porch That Became His Kingdom

Ace’s favorite place was the front porch — his little kingdom where he could feel the breeze, watch the world go by, and soak up the sun. Norma often let him sit outside to enjoy the day but, wanting to keep him safe, she installed a small security camera.

She never expected it to capture anything unusual — maybe a yawn, a stretch, or a lazy roll in the afternoon light. But one day, as she reviewed the footage, she froze.

Someone was visiting Ace.


The Mysterious Visitor

A young boy from the neighborhood had begun stopping by — not once, but almost every day. He would walk up the porch steps quietly, his movements slow and respectful, as though he were approaching an old friend.

Ace, recognizing him instantly, would perk up, his tail flicking with excitement. He’d trot toward the boy, brushing against his legs in greeting. There was no fear, no hesitation — only warmth.

And the boy? He didn’t flinch at Ace’s appearance. He didn’t see the missing eye or the scar. He saw Ace, the living, breathing soul in front of him. He knelt beside the cat, whispered softly, and stroked his fur with gentle hands — always careful, always kind.

When Norma first watched the video, her breath caught in her throat. The tenderness between them was wordless but powerful. “It melted our hearts,” she said later. “You could feel the love through the screen.”


A Friendship Without Words

Their connection grew day by day. Sometimes they’d just sit together in silence — the boy quietly petting Ace as the world went on around them. Other times, Ace would curl up beside him, purring softly while the boy smiled down at him like a little guardian angel.

No toys. No noise. Just quiet companionship.

It wasn’t the kind of friendship you plan — it was the kind that simply happens when two souls recognize each other’s need for love.


The Moment They Finally Met

One afternoon, Norma saw the boy approaching again. This time, she decided to step outside. She didn’t want to scare him — she just wanted to thank him for the kindness he had shown her cat.

With a gentle smile, she said, “You can visit him anytime you like.”

The boy’s face lit up instantly. His grin stretched from ear to ear, his eyes shining with pure joy. It was as if he had been waiting for permission to belong — to know that his visits were welcome.

From that moment on, it was official: Ace had a best friend.


What It Means to Be Seen

As the days passed, Ace was never alone on the porch again. The boy kept coming back, rain or shine, always finding comfort in the cat’s company. And Ace, in turn, found something he’d never had before — someone who saw past the scar, straight into his heart.

“He doesn’t see Ace as broken,” Norma reflected. “He just sees a friend.”
